Scala dei Turchi

One of the most famous cliffs in the world for its beauty and the contrast of colors with the blue of the sea and the sky and the white of the marl.The Scala dei Turchi takes its name from the Saracen pirates, improperly called Turks by the local populations (this is how the Arab people were conventionally called), who in the 16th century used to land on the particular rock formation to plunder the villages on the coast such as the current Realmonte.

Is the Scala dei Turchi Free?

Yes. Scala dei Turchi Access is absolutely free , the only time you have to pay is if you want to climb up on it (see more on other FAQs).

Can I Climb up the Scala dei Turchi?

Yes. In a controlled and limited manner. you have to book in advance and pay the ticket (5 euros/person) trough the website here .

which are opening hours

It is always open, but climb up ticket is allowed from 10 a.m. to 7 p.m. (or to Sunset if it is early) .

Is there a parking area?

Yes . There are 2 private payment Parking areas (6 euros<4h , 10 euros >4h or full day)  or you usually can also park the car for free along the road , only in the coast side, not in curve , not front house gates , and not after no parking sign.

How can I reach Scala dei Turchi site?

Besides your /rented car or taxi you can reach Scala dei turchi also by bus , there is no train to get there.

Temple bus from Agrigento: back and forth available from June to September bring you to main entrance to Scala dei Turchi (listed as entrance 1 on this page map): https://www.templetourbusagrigento.com/en/home/

Regular bus from Agrigento: back and forth avaiable the whole year but it bring you just close to a beach in Porto Empedocle and you need to walk (trough a comfortable sandy beach) about 40 minutes to reach Scala dei Turchi https://www.autolineesal.it/en/timetables
